OSDN Git Service

meson: recommend building the surfaceless platform
authorEmil Velikov <emil.velikov@collabora.com>
Fri, 23 Feb 2018 19:32:01 +0000 (19:32 +0000)
committerEmil Velikov <emil.l.velikov@gmail.com>
Wed, 8 Aug 2018 12:37:09 +0000 (13:37 +0100)
It has no special requirements, size and build-time is effectively zero.

v2: Rebase

Signed-off-by: Emil Velikov <emil.velikov@collabora.com>
Acked-by: Dylan Baker <dylan@pnwbakers.com>
Reviewed-by: Adam Jackson <ajax@redhat.com>
meson.build

index 661cbba..334cf96 100644 (file)
@@ -304,7 +304,7 @@ elif _egl == 'true'
   elif not with_shared_glapi
     error('EGL requires shared-glapi')
   elif not with_platforms
-    error('No platforms specified, consider -Dplatforms=drm,x11 at least')
+    error('No platforms specified, consider -Dplatforms=drm,x11,surfaceless at least')
   elif not ['disabled', 'dri'].contains(with_glx)
     error('EGL requires dri, but a GLX is being built without dri')
   endif